PARAMETRIC OPERATION
The
PMQ-210 Parametric Equalizer puts an incredible amount of
control in your hands. Correctly adjusted, it can solve many of the
problems you will encounter along your road to perfect sound.
Incorrectly adjusted, it can cause just as many problems. By following
these guidelines, you will avoid common pitfalls in system tuning and
get your sound quickly dialed in. We recommend that you use a Real
Time Analyzer (RTA) to speed things up, but it is possible to tune your
system without it.
It is important to understand what a parametric equalizer actually
controls to be able to use one effectively. On the face of the detachable
control panel are ten sets of three controls each. On the top row are
the frequency selection controls, which allow you to dial in the exact
frequencies in need of adjustment. There are ten overlapping ranges
that cover the entire audio spectrum. The second row consists of the
"Q" adjustment from 1.5 to 4 for each frequency selected. Q is an
indication of how wide or narrow the adjusted bandwidth is. A low Q
(1.5) will affect a wide range of frequencies around the selected center
frequency resulting in a gently curved shape, while a high Q (4) affects
a narrow band resulting in a peaked shape as shown below. The last
row of controls determines the amount of cut or boost,
±
12dB, at each
selected frequency.
